## Reviewing Userland extraction PRs

PRs splitting the user module out of the Tanager monolith follow the strangler pattern: new endpoints land in the Userland service, old ones get a deprecation shim. Reject any PR that writes directly to the legacy users table. Migration checklists live in the Falk wiki. For context on sequencing decisions, contact the extraction lead below.

escalation mailbox, bafog-fafog: ulador@paliqlabs.internal

**Vendor note: Inkmill markdown pipeline**

Rendering for Parchway docs is outsourced to Inkmill under an annual contract, renewing each March. They handle sanitization and PDF export; we own the upload queue. SLA: 4-hour response on rendering failures. Escalate only after two failed retries. Their support desk is reachable at the address below.

billing contact of hahaf-baguf = zorael.tammir.jorius@sivrelhq.internal

Fan-out backpressure for the Quillet notifier: when the queue depth crosses the soft limit, the dispatcher sheds low-priority pushes and batches the rest at 500ms intervals. Reviewer should confirm the shed counter is exported and that retries respect the jitter window. Once merged, the release artifact gets re-signed by the pipeline, which expects the deploy key shown below.

deploy key for bawep-yawif: bky6_GQhaSt

## Planner regression — plugin authors

Heads up: the Burrowquery 4.1 planner started picking nested-loop joins for anything touching plugin-registered virtual tables, which tanks latency badly. Until the fix lands, plugins should declare row estimates explicitly rather than relying on the default cardinality guess. If your users report slow scans, this is almost certainly why. To reproduce locally, run the planner with the override settings below.

service settings:
HOLDOR_PIN=6477
HOLDOR_METRICS_HOST=metrics.holdor.nelvrocorp.corp
HOLDOR_LOG_LEVEL=error
HOLDOR_TENANT=noviel